Megabank groups to trim new grad hiring in 2018
April 5, 2017
TOKYO- Japan's three megabank groups including Bank of Tokyo-Mitsubishi UFJ will trim their hiring of new graduates in spring 2018 as they did in the previous year, Jiji Press learned Tuesday.
The core unit of Mitsubishi UFJ Financial Group Inc. expects to employ some 1,100 new graduates next spring, down from about 1,200 this spring.
At Sumitomo Mitsui Banking Corp., under the wing of Sumitomo Mitsui Financial Group Inc. new hires are seen falling below 1,000 for the first time in six years. This spring, the bank employed 1,347 new graduates. (Jiji Press)
